testsharemem.dpr

来自「delphi源代码分析源码」· DPR 代码 · 共 36 行

DPR
36
字号
program TestShareMem;

{$APPTYPE CONSOLE}

uses
  ShareMemRep,
  SysUtils;

function GetStringFromDLL(S : String) : String;
  external 'TestDll.dll';

var
  S : String = 'Hehe, It''s very COOL...';

procedure OutputString;
var
  Str : String;
  i : integer;
begin
  try
    i := 0;
    Str := IntToStr(5 div i);
  except
    on E:Exception do
      writeln('Exception Support in EXE -> '#$0D#$0A'  ', E.Message);
  end;

  Str := GetStringFromDLL(S);
  Writeln;
  Writeln(Str);
end;

begin
  OutputString;
end.

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?